Early Career and Dancing Background
Before becoming Hollywood’s most memorable “villain,” Hendrix was making bank as a professional dancer and model. She worked with major brands like Nike, Levi’s, Mattel, and Sun Microsystems, plus danced in music videos for hip-hop legends including MC Hammer, Keith Sweat, and Whodini. This early success laid the financial foundation for her acting transition after a bicycle accident in 1992 ended her dancing career.

Biography: From Tennessee Small Town to Hollywood Stardom
Early Life and Family Background
Born Katherine Elaine Hendrix on December 28, 1970, in Oak Ridge, Tennessee, she grew up in a military family while her father served in Vietnam. Her diverse heritage includes Italian, Danish, Irish, and English roots, contributing to her distinctive look that made her perfect for playing sophisticated antagonists.
Career Timeline and Major Milestones
1992-1995: The Foundation Years
- Moved to Los Angeles after bicycle accident ended dancing career
- First TV appearance on “Doogie Howser, M.D.”
- Recurring role as Agent 66 on “Get Smart”
1997-1998: Breakthrough Period
- “Romy and Michele’s High School Reunion” established her mean-girl persona
- “The Parent Trap” made her a household name worldwide
2001-2022: Television Success
- “The Chronicle” (2001-2002) as Kristen Martin
- “Joan of Arcadia” (2003-2005) as Ms. Lischak
- “Dynasty” reboot (2019-2022) bringing her back to primetime
Personal Life and Activism
Relationship Status and Family
Hendrix has been in a long-term relationship with Christopher J. Corabi and previously dated actor David Faustino from 1995-1997. She’s chosen not to have children, focusing instead on her career and animal advocacy work.
Animal Rights Activism
A passionate vegan since 2006, Hendrix serves as Director of Marketing and Public Relations for Animal Rescue Corps. She’s also a spokesperson for In Defense of Animals and regularly participates in Pets 90210 adoption events, using her platform to promote animal welfare.
